#0d1451 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0d1451 is composed of 5.1% red, 7.8% green and 31.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84% cyan, 75.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 68.2% black. It has a hue angle of 233.8 degrees, a saturation of 72.3% and a lightness of 18.4%. #0d1451 color hex could be obtained by blending #1a28a2 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000066.

Shades and Tints of #0d1451

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#02030d is the darkest color, while #fbfcfe is the lightest one.
